On Thu, Dec 14, 2023 at 12:40:13PM +0300, Serge Semin wrote: > Hi Yoshihiro > > On Thu, Dec 14, 2023 at 02:35:56AM +0000, Yoshihiro Shimoda wrote: > > Hello PCIe maintainers, > > > > > From: Yoshihiro Shimoda, Sent: Tuesday, November 14, 2023 2:55 PM > > > > > > This patch series tidies the code of PCIe dwc controllers and some > > > controllers up. > > > > > > Changes from v1: > > > https://lore.kernel.org/linux-pci/20231113013300.2132152-1-yoshihiro.shimoda.uh@xxxxxxxxxxx/ > > > - Based on the latest pci.git / next branch. > > > - Add a new patch to drop host prefix of members from dw_pcie_host_ops > > > in the patch 1/6. > > > - Add Reviewed-by tag in the patch 3/6. > > > - Drop unneeded local variable in the patch 4/6. > > > - Add new patches to resolve issues of clang warnings in the patch [56]/6. > > > > > > Justin Stitt (1): > > > PCI: iproc: fix -Wvoid-pointer-to-enum-cast warning > > > > > > Yoshihiro Shimoda (5): > > > PCI: dwc: Drop host prefix from struct dw_pcie_host_ops > > > PCI: dwc: Rename to .init in struct dw_pcie_ep_ops > > > PCI: dwc: Rename to .get_dbi_offset in struct dw_pcie_ep_ops > > > PCI: dwc: Add dw_pcie_ep_{read,write}_dbi[2] helpers > > > PCI: rcar-gen4: fix -Wvoid-pointer-to-enum-cast warning > > > > According to the patchwork [1], all patches have Reviewed-by tags. > > So, I think the patches are acceptable for upstream, but what do you think? > > I confirmed that the patches can be applied into the latest pci.git / next branch. > > What actually matters is to get all Manivannan or Jingoo or Gustavo > acks (the later two maintainers are unlikely to respond though) or any > higher maintainers approval. AFAICS this patch still hasn't got any > maintainers ack: > https://patchwork.kernel.org/project/linux-pci/patch/20231114055456.2231990-5-yoshihiro.shimoda.uh@xxxxxxxxxxx/ > https://lore.kernel.org/linux-pci/20231114055456.2231990-5-yoshihiro.shimoda.uh@xxxxxxxxxxx/ > I guess it's connected with a request to move the helpers to the > header file. > Yes. I recommended moving the helpers to header file to keep the consistency and there was no reply from Yoshihiro. Yoshihiro, should you have any objections, please counter in the patch thread 4/6. Otherwise, please implement the proposed change. - Mani > -Serge(y) > > > > > [1] > > https://patchwork.kernel.org/project/linux-pci/list/?series=800901 > > > > Best regards, > > Yoshihiro Shimoda > > > > > drivers/pci/controller/dwc/pci-dra7xx.c | 4 +- > > > drivers/pci/controller/dwc/pci-exynos.c | 2 +- > > > drivers/pci/controller/dwc/pci-imx6.c | 6 +- > > > drivers/pci/controller/dwc/pci-keystone.c | 8 +- > > > .../pci/controller/dwc/pci-layerscape-ep.c | 7 +- > > > drivers/pci/controller/dwc/pci-layerscape.c | 2 +- > > > drivers/pci/controller/dwc/pci-meson.c | 2 +- > > > drivers/pci/controller/dwc/pcie-al.c | 2 +- > > > drivers/pci/controller/dwc/pcie-armada8k.c | 2 +- > > > drivers/pci/controller/dwc/pcie-artpec6.c | 4 +- > > > drivers/pci/controller/dwc/pcie-bt1.c | 4 +- > > > .../pci/controller/dwc/pcie-designware-ep.c | 249 ++++++++++-------- > > > .../pci/controller/dwc/pcie-designware-host.c | 30 +-- > > > .../pci/controller/dwc/pcie-designware-plat.c | 2 +- > > > drivers/pci/controller/dwc/pcie-designware.h | 12 +- > > > drivers/pci/controller/dwc/pcie-dw-rockchip.c | 2 +- > > > drivers/pci/controller/dwc/pcie-fu740.c | 2 +- > > > drivers/pci/controller/dwc/pcie-histb.c | 2 +- > > > drivers/pci/controller/dwc/pcie-intel-gw.c | 2 +- > > > drivers/pci/controller/dwc/pcie-keembay.c | 2 +- > > > drivers/pci/controller/dwc/pcie-kirin.c | 2 +- > > > drivers/pci/controller/dwc/pcie-qcom-ep.c | 2 +- > > > drivers/pci/controller/dwc/pcie-qcom.c | 6 +- > > > drivers/pci/controller/dwc/pcie-rcar-gen4.c | 12 +- > > > drivers/pci/controller/dwc/pcie-spear13xx.c | 2 +- > > > drivers/pci/controller/dwc/pcie-tegra194.c | 2 +- > > > drivers/pci/controller/dwc/pcie-uniphier-ep.c | 2 +- > > > drivers/pci/controller/dwc/pcie-uniphier.c | 2 +- > > > drivers/pci/controller/dwc/pcie-visconti.c | 2 +- > > > drivers/pci/controller/pcie-iproc-platform.c | 2 +- > > > 30 files changed, 203 insertions(+), 177 deletions(-) > > > > > > -- > > > 2.34.1 > > > > > -- மணிவண்ணன் சதாசிவம்